204.To ask the Minister for Finance the full-year cost if the single person child carer credit increased by €200. [25531/24]

Photo of Michael McGrathMichael McGrath (Cork South Central,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source

Based on Revenue’s latest Ready Reckoner (post-Budget 2024), the estimated cost to the Exchequer of increasing the Single Person Child Carer Credit from €1,750 to €1,950 per annum is approximately €10.4 million on a first year basis and €12.0 million on a full year basis.

It should be noted that the Ready Reckoner provides estimated costs and yields arising from changes to a wide range of taxes and duties. Amounts other than those shown in the Ready Reckoner can be extrapolated using a straight line or pro-rata calculation.
